Albany, New York, wears the mantle of history with grace, best known as one of the oldest continuously chartered cities in the United States. Its allure lies in the rich tapestry of historical sites like the New York State Capitol and the Empire State Plaza, which narrate the state’s past. Beyond history, Albany beckons with a vibrant cultural scene, boasting theaters, museums, and lively festivals that captivate the curious traveler.
For those seeking relaxation amidst natural beauty, RV camping offers an ideal escape. Imagine awakening to the whispering leaves and the call of songbirds in serene campgrounds. Cherry Plain State Park, nestled beside Black River Pond, is a tranquil oasis for RV campers, offering fishing, hiking, and swimming.
Thompson’s Lake State Park is another gem, where campers can unwind by the lakeshore or explore the surrounding woodlands. Albany’s blend of history, culture, and outdoor serenity makes it an enticing destination, and RV camping provides the perfect gateway to savor its many charms.
Within a two-hour radius of Albany, New York, lies a treasure trove of outdoor adventures and natural wonders. Head west to the Catskill Mountains, a realm of rolling peaks, cascading waterfalls, and dense forests. Here, hiking trails like Kaaterskill Falls or Overlook Mountain beckon explorers with their majestic views and serene solitude.
Venturing north, the Adirondack Park unfolds, offering a vast playground for outdoor enthusiasts. With countless lakes, including Lake George and Saranac Lake, it’s perfect for boating, fishing, and swimming. Hikers can tackle the High Peaks, while kayakers and canoers will revel in the pristine waterways.
To the east, the Berkshire Mountains in Massachusetts invite visitors with their picturesque landscapes, charming towns, and cultural attractions like the Norman Rockwell Museum. And don’t forget the Green Mountains of Vermont to the north, a paradise for skiing, hiking, and experiencing the splendor of fall foliage.
Within this radius of Albany, nature lovers will find themselves spoiled for choice, with diverse landscapes that promise adventure, tranquility, and a deeper connection with the great outdoors.
The Albany, New York area is blessed with a collection of RV parks and campgrounds, each offering its unique blend of amenities and attractions. One gem is Thompson’s Lake State Park Campground, where RV campers can embrace lakeside serenity, ideal for swimming, fishing, or simply soaking in the tranquil ambiance. With hiking trails meandering through lush woods, it’s a haven for nature enthusiasts.
Cherry Plain State Park Campground, nestled beside Black River Pond, is another peaceful oasis for RV campers, offering not only camping but also boating, hiking, and picnicking by the water’s edge. Imagine the joy of watching the sunset reflect on the pond’s surface.
For those seeking a bit of history with their camping, consider Schodack Island State Park Campground, where you can explore the remnants of an 18th-century farmstead and enjoy riverside relaxation. Additionally, its extensive trails are perfect for hiking and bird-watching.
These RV parks near Albany provide a range of experiences, from lakeside bliss to historical immersion, ensuring a memorable camping getaway in the heart of New York’s beauty.
Albany, New York, offers a rich tapestry of experiences for visitors. For shopping, Stuyvesant Plaza is an elegant open-air mall with upscale boutiques, while the Crossgates Mall provides a diverse retail experience. Dining in Albany is a culinary journey with establishments like Jack’s Oyster House serving classic dishes. Lively nightlife awaits on Lark Street, where bars and restaurants come to life after dark.
History buffs can explore the New York State Capitol, a stunning architectural marvel, or delve into the past at the Albany Institute of History & Art. The USS Slater, a WWII destroyer escort, offers a unique glimpse into naval history. The Children’s Museum of Science and Technology captivates young minds with interactive exhibits, while the Albany Institute of History & Art provides a cultural journey through art and history.
While camping in an RV rental, visitors can partake in popular events like the Tulip Festival, a celebration of Albany’s Dutch heritage with vibrant tulip displays, or Alive at Five, a summer concert series by the river. Albany’s fusion of history, culture, and contemporary charm promises an enriching experience for all.
